The Defense Logistics Agency awarded Contract SPE7M126P3278 to CENTROID, INC. (CAGE 21856) on July 14, 2026, for the procurement of 12 units of a circuit card assembly identified by NSN 5998005298635 and procurement request number 7011805102, at a total contract value of $99,996.00. The award stems from solicitation SPE7M0-25-T-8067 and is administered under simplified acquisition procedures, consistent with FAR 13.302(a) or 12.303(a), indicating a low-value, non-complex transaction typically handled through streamlined processes. The contract is performed at CENTROID, INC.’s location in Plainview, New York, with the DLA Land and Maritime, Maritime Supply Chain office in Columbus, Ohio, serving as the issuing and payment office.
